The Stoxx Europe 600 is a widely followed index that tracks the performance of 600 large, mid, and small-cap companies in the European region, making it a key benchmark for the overall health of the European stock market. A 22% increase in profits for these companies would be a significant improvement, potentially indicating a strong rebound in corporate earnings. This earnings growth could have a substantial impact on investor sentiment and market trends, as it suggests that many European companies are weathering global economic uncertainties relatively well.
